Features
1. Compact Design
2. 32 bit DSP (digital signal processor) hardware platform
3. Advanced control algorithm, the main control board features an integrated PG card
4. Directly installed encoder into the terminal can realize PG closed-loop vector control
5. Two kinds of control methods, including speed vector control and torque vector control, making the inverter control high precision, fast speed reaction, and excellent low frequency
6. Intelligent inspection and high level of protection.
7. Keyboard with digital potentiometer, for easy speed adjustment.

Parameters
item Item description
Input Rated volt, frequency 1 phase 220 volt. level : 1 phase 220V , 50Hz/60Hz 3 phase 380 volt. level : 3 phase 380V , 50Hz/60Hz
Allowed volt. range 1 phase 220 volt. level : 200 ~ 260V 3 phase 380 volt. level : 320 ~ 460V
Output Voltage 0 ~ 380V
Frequency 0 ~ 600Hz
Overload capacity 150% of rated current for 1 minute
Control performance Control mode Vector control (Without PG) Vector control (with PG) Open-loop V/F control Torque control (without PG) Torque control (with PG)
Speed control accuracy ±0.5% rated synchronous speed ( without PG vector control) ±0.1% rated synchronous speed ( with PG vector control) ; ±1% rated synchronous speed ( V/F control );
Speed regulation range 1 : 2000 ( with PG vector control ); 1 : 100 ( without PG vector control ); 1 : 50 ( V/F control );
Start-up torque 1.0Hz : 150% rated torque ( V/F control ); 0.5Hz : 150% rated torque(without PG vector control) ; 0Hz : 180% rated torque ( with PG vector control );
Speed fluctuation ±0.3% rated synchronous speed ( without PG vector control ); ±0.1% rated synchronous speed ( with PG vector control );;
Torque control accuracy ±10% rated torque ( without PG vector control , without PG torque control ); ±5% rated torque ( with PG vector control, with PG torque control )。
Torque response ≤20ms ( without PG vector control ); ≤10ms ( with PG vector control );
Frequency precision Digital setting : max. frequency×±0.01% ; Analog setting : max. frequency×±0.5%
Frequency resolution Analog setting 0.1% of max. frequency
Digital setting precision 0.01Hz
Exterior impulse 0.1% of max. frequency
Torque boost Automatic torque boost, manual torque boost 0.1 ~ 12.0%
V/F curve(volt. frequency characteristic) Setting rated frequency arbitrarily at range of 5 ~ 650Hz,can choose constant torque, decreasing torque1, decreasing torque 2, decreasing torque 3,self-defined V/F curve in total 5 kinds of curve
Acceleration And Deceleration curves Two modes: straight line acceleration and deceleration, "S" curve acceleration and deceleration; 15 types of acceleration and deceleration time, the time unit is optional(0.01s,0.1s,1s), max is 1000 minutes
Brake Power consumption brake With built-in brake unit, brake resistor added between (+) and PB
DC brake Start-up and stop action optional, action frequency 0 ~ 15Hz,action current 0 ~ 100% of rated current, action time 0 ~ 30.0s
